The review article by Yang, Yao and colleagues discusses recent advancements in biofunctional DNA hydrogels and DNA nanocomplexes based on rolling circle amplification (RCA), and introduces assembly strategies and functionalization methods of ultralong single-strand DNA produced by RCA.
